Aber ich Idiot hab leider was vergessen -.- Es soll natürlich auch die Stufe von jedem Skill dabeistehen. Also zB "Skillname 1 Stufe 0" und wenn er aufgewertet wird soll er heißen "Skillname 1 Stufe 1". Die Stufe wäre dann für jeden Skill also auch nochmal eine Variable, die sich aktualisieren muss.
Würdest du das noch mit einbauen? Sorry, ich hätte da eigentlich vorher dran denken müssen...
Alternativ kannst du es auch so machen (sofern das einfacher zu skripten wäre) dass sich das Icon des jeweiligen Skills aktualisiert, wenn die Stufe eines Skills ansteigt. Dann mach ich verschiedene Icons, wo ich die Zahl reinschreibe von der Stufe, die der Skill grad hat.
Aber ansonsten bin ich begeistert. Es tut genau das, was es soll! Großartig!
Geändert von Ken der Kot (04.03.2018 um 15:39 Uhr)
Here you are. Hatte auch vorher schon überlegt, das einfach mit einzubauen - war aber auf dem Sprung und hab es deshalb erstmal nicht gemacht
Habe dir beides ermöglicht. Du kannst sowohl beim Icon, als auch bei den Skillnamen ein Array eintragen.
Gibst du "Skillname 2" einfach nur ein, heißt der Skill immer "Skillname 2" - unabhängig vom Level. Willst du unterscheidungen im Namen haben, gibst du folgendes ein:
["Skillname 2","Skillname 2 Stufe X", ...]
Falls du also Arrays verwendest, musst du nur schauen, dass die Anzahl der Skillnamen/Icons gleich der Anzahl der Kosten ist. (Kosten [5,8,9,-1] bedeutet z.B., der Skill hat Stufe 0, Stufe 1, Stufe 2 und Stufe 3. Namen brauchst du dann also auch 4 Icons und/oder Namen.
Danke für deine Mühe. Kannst du mir das mit den Arrays erklären? Denn wenn ich den Skill 3 aufwerten will, kommt die Frage "Skillname 3 MAX aufwerten?" Es soll ja einfach nur kommen "Skillname3 aufwerten?" oder "Skillname3 Stufe 0 aufwerten?"
Bei den anderen Skills kommt dann als Frage "k aufwerten?", "S aufwerten?" und "l aufwerten?". Das verstehe ich nicht und die Stelle im Skript, wo das definiert ist, finde ich leider nicht. Was mich wundert, denn eigentlich ist das Skript sehr übersichtlich, aber offenbar übersehe ich es dennoch?
Vielen Dank, Linkey!!! Falls noch was wäre, ich was nicht verstehe oder sonstwas nicht funktioniert, meld ich mich nochmal. Sieht aktuell so aus, als funktioniert alles! Danke für die Zeit, die du dir für mich genommen hast. Werd das hier im Laufe des Abends und Morgen mal alles soweit auf meine Bedürfnisse anpassen und dann einen Screen zeigen, damit man das alles mal in Action sieht Danke nochmal, cooler Typ echt!
Also, wie versprochen ein Screen vom Ergebnis, das ich dank Linkey realisieren konnte. Sagt auch gerne was zu den Icons! Ich hab noch nie selber Icons gemacht, daher bin ich auch hier gierig auf Feedback der konstruktivsten Sorte.
Freut mich, dass ich dir helfen konnte. Sieht gut aus. Kann an den Icons nichts bemängeln, bin in Fragen bezüglich der Grafik aber auch keine wirklich gute Anlaufstelle :P
Wenn es kleine Dinge sind, helfe ich gerne wieder - das hier hatte doch ein paar Stunden gedauert und passt momentan nicht so gut in meinen Zeitplan (beim XP kenn ich die meisten Basic-Klassen, beim ACE muss ich immer wieder schauen, wie genau das Handling der Windows funktioniert )